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software is an essential tool for businesses that want to improve their sales and customer service. CRM solutions allow companies to manage their interactions with customers, automate their sales process, and improve their overall customer experience.
What are the key features of a CRM system?
A CRM system includes a variety of features that help businesses manage their customer interactions. Here are some of the key features:
Contact Management
A CRM system allows businesses to store all their customer information in one place. Contact management features include the ability to create and manage customer profiles, view and track customer interactions, and segment customers based on specific criteria.
Sales Force Automation
Sales force automation features help businesses manage their sales process. This includes lead management, opportunity tracking, and pipeline management. Automation can simplify the sales process, reduce errors, and ensure that sales are closed in a timely manner.
Marketing Automation
Marketing automation features allow businesses to automate their marketing campaigns. This includes email marketing, social media marketing, and other types of marketing. Automation can reduce the time and effort required to run marketing campaigns, while improving their effectiveness.
Customer Service and Support
A CRM system can also help businesses manage their customer service and support efforts. This includes the ability to track customer issues, manage service requests, and provide customer self-service options. By improving customer service, businesses can improve customer satisfaction and loyalty.
Analytics and Reporting
A CRM system can provide businesses with valuable insights into their customer interactions. This includes the ability to track sales performance, monitor customer behavior, and measure the success of marketing campaigns. Analytics and reporting features can help businesses make data-driven decisions and improve their overall performance.
What are the benefits of using a CRM system?
Using a CRM system can provide businesses with a range of benefits. Here are some of the key benefits:
Improved Customer Relationships
A CRM system can help businesses improve their relationships with customers. By storing all customer information in one place, businesses can provide better customer service, personalize their interactions with customers, and tailor their marketing efforts to individual customers.
Increased Efficiency
A CRM system can help businesses automate many of their sales and marketing tasks. This can save time and reduce the risk of human error. Automation can also help businesses close sales more quickly and improve their overall efficiency.
Better Data Management
A CRM system can help businesses manage their data more effectively. By storing all customer information in one place, businesses can reduce the risk of data loss or duplication. This can improve data quality and make it easier to track customer interactions over time.
Improved Reporting and Analytics
A CRM system can provide businesses with valuable insights into their customer interactions. By tracking customer behavior and measuring the success of marketing campaigns, businesses can make data-driven decisions and improve their overall performance.
What factors should you consider when choosing a CRM system?
Choosing the right CRM system is an important decision for businesses. Here are some factors to consider:
Scalability
Businesses should choose a CRM system that can grow with their needs. The system should be able to handle increased customer volume, additional features, and integrations with other software.
User-Friendliness
The CRM system should be easy to use and navigate. The user interface should be intuitive and simple, with clear instructions and prompts.
Integration
The CRM system should be able to integrate with other software and tools used by the business. This includes email marketing software, ecommerce platforms, and accounting software.
Cost
The cost of the CRM system should be considered in relation to the benefits it provides. Businesses should look for a system that provides good value for the cost, with a range of pricing options to suit their budget.
Customer Support
The CRM system should come with good customer support. This includes access to a help desk, video tutorials, and a knowledge base. Businesses should also consider the availability of customer support, including hours of operation and response times.
